Smoking nicotine has long been associated with various health risks and social consequences. If you’re wondering why it’s good not to smoke nicotine, here are several compelling reasons that can help you understand the benefits of staying nicotine-free.

1. What Are the Health Benefits of Not Smoking Nicotine?

  • Avoiding Serious Diseases: One of the most significant benefits of not smoking nicotine is the reduced risk of developing life-threatening diseases. Smoking is a leading cause of heart disease, stroke, lung cancer, and respiratory illnesses. By not smoking, you protect your heart, lungs, and overall health.
  • Improved Respiratory Function: Smoking damages the lungs and airways, leading to chronic conditions like bronchitis and emphysema. When you avoid nicotine, your lungs can function more efficiently, making breathing easier and reducing the risk of respiratory complications.

2. How Does Not Smoking Affect Your Appearance?

  • Better Skin Health: Smoking accelerates the aging process, leading to wrinkles, dull skin, and a loss of elasticity. Nicotine restricts blood flow to the skin, depriving it of essential nutrients. By not smoking, your skin retains its youthful glow and elasticity longer.
  • Improved Oral Hygiene: Smoking stains teeth and increases the risk of gum disease and bad breath. Quitting nicotine helps maintain a brighter smile and fresher breath, contributing to better oral health and confidence.

3. What Are the Financial Advantages of Not Smoking Nicotine?

  • Saving Money: Smoking is an expensive habit. The cost of cigarettes, vaping devices, and related products adds up quickly. By not smoking, you save a substantial amount of money that can be used for more meaningful and rewarding pursuits.
  • Lower Healthcare Costs: Smokers are more likely to face costly medical bills due to smoking-related illnesses. Avoiding nicotine reduces your risk of developing these conditions, potentially saving you money on healthcare expenses in the long run.

4. How Does Not Smoking Nicotine Improve Your Quality of Life?

  • Increased Energy Levels: Nicotine can interfere with your body’s ability to use oxygen effectively, leading to fatigue and decreased stamina. When you avoid nicotine, your energy levels improve, allowing you to engage in physical activities and enjoy a more active lifestyle.
  • Enhanced Sense of Taste and Smell: Smoking dulls your senses, particularly taste and smell. By quitting, you regain these senses, allowing you to enjoy food, scents, and experiences more fully.

5. How Does Not Smoking Benefit Your Mental Health?

  • Reduced Anxiety and Stress: While some people smoke to cope with stress, nicotine can actually increase anxiety and irritability. By not smoking, you avoid the mood swings associated with nicotine addiction, leading to a more stable and positive mental state.
  • Better Sleep: Nicotine is a stimulant that can disrupt your sleep patterns. Smokers often experience insomnia or poor-quality sleep. Quitting nicotine helps regulate your sleep, leading to more restful nights and improved overall well-being.

6. How Does Not Smoking Affect Your Social Life?

  • Positive Social Interactions: Smoking can isolate you from non-smokers and create social barriers. By not smoking, you avoid these divisions and enjoy more inclusive, positive interactions with others.
  • Improved Relationships: Non-smokers often appreciate the effort to stay nicotine-free, leading to stronger, healthier relationships. You also avoid exposing others to secondhand smoke, which can harm their health.

Conclusion

If you’ve ever wondered why it’s good not to smoke nicotine, the reasons are clear: better health, improved appearance, financial savings, enhanced quality of life, and positive social interactions. By choosing not to smoke, you make a powerful commitment to your well-being and future. The benefits of staying nicotine-free far outweigh any temporary satisfaction that smoking might provide.
